2 of 400: A conversation with voters
by Tom Crann, Minnesota Public RadioApril 1, 2009
Four hundred ballots. That's what Minnesota's U.S. Senate race appears to have come down to. On April 7, the three-judge panel hearing Norm Coleman's election contest will open some of the 400 previously-rejected absentee ballots.
All Things Considered had a conversation with two of the 400 voters who's ballots are suddenly the center of attention.
Nichole Miller lives in Eagen and Vincent Hanson is from Wayzata.
